All across NJ, particularly as our state begins its recovery from a global pandemic, families are struggling in ways they haven’t before. Advocates for the Immigrant Community are often some of the first to recognize a family is – or has become – at risk. The NJ Department of Children and Families offers programs and services to empower and support families so that their children can thrive. From preventative initiatives to behavioral health services to skill building, child protection and basic needs support, NJ DCF has an array of resources available to ALL NJ families.
